Makeup of the Eye


The eye includes several key elements that interact to promote vision.



  • Cornea: The clear front layer that refracts light entering the eye.

  • Lens: Emphases light onto the retina, readjusting form for far and wide vision.

  • Retina: Contains photoreceptor cells (rods and cones) that convert light into neural signals.

  • Optic Nerve: Transmits visual information to the brain.


Understanding these parts helps identify how they contribute to clear vision and overall eye health and wellness. Appropriate functioning of each part is essential to stop vision problems. Any kind of damages or disease affecting these frameworks can bring about significant visual impairment.


Common Eye Disorders


A number of eye disorders can affect vision, needing focus from main eye treatment professionals.



  • Cataracts: Clouding of the lens, resulting in blurred vision.

  • Glaucoma: Raised pressure within the eye, damaging the optic nerve.

  • Macular Degeneration: Deterioration of the retina, creating central vision loss.

  • Dry Eye Disorder: Insufficient tear production, causing pain.


Knowing these problems allows people to notice signs and symptoms early and seek ideal treatment. Routine examinations can assist in very early detection and monitoring of these disorders, preserving eye wellness.

Optometrists vs. Ophthalmologists


Optometrists and ophthalmologists serve different functions in eye treatment. Optometrists are trained to analyze, detect, and deal with different eye problems. They can suggest glasses or get in touch with lenses and take care of some eye diseases. In contrast, ophthalmologists are clinical physicians who focus on eye and vision care. They execute surgery, treat eye illness, and can handle much more intricate conditions.

Advanced Diagnostic Evaluating


Advanced analysis screening is important for identifying intricate eye problems. Strategies such as Optical Coherence Tomography (OCT) provide comprehensive images of the retina, helping experts examine diseases like macular degeneration and diabetic retinopathy.


Various other tests might include Visual Field testing and fundus photography. These techniques aid to keep an eye on diseases that might otherwise cause significant vision loss.


Advanced screening can also help in customizing therapy plans. By recognizing the precise nature of an eye condition, experts can offer targeted therapies to enhance individual outcomes.

Adult Vision Care


Grownups encounter various vision difficulties that often emerge from way of life aspects. Routine examinations are suggested every two years for those under 50 and every year for those over. Problems like presbyopia, which affects near vision, generally develop with age.


Maintaining eye health and wellness entails taking care of systemic problems such as diabetic issues and high blood pressure. Adequate use UV safety glasses is vital when outdoors. Protective measures at the office, especially for display direct exposure, consist of the 20-20-20 regulation: every 20 mins, take a look at something 20 feet away for 20 seconds.

UV Defense and Sunglasses


Ultra-violet (UV) radiation postures substantial threats to eye wellness. Lasting direct exposure to UV rays can cause cataracts and other eye disorders. High-grade sunglasses are vital for defense versus these harmful rays.


When picking sunglasses, look for lenses that block 100% of UVA and UVB rays. Polarized lenses reduce glow, offering more clear vision while outdoors. Wrap-around styles use additional protection by restricting UV direct exposure from the sides.

Nourishment and Eye Wellness


Diet plan plays a critical role in protecting vision. Nutrients such as vitamins A, C, and E, in addition to omega-3 fatty acids, add to eye health. Leafed environment-friendlies, fish, and colorful fruits must be included on a regular basis in the diet regimen.


Foods rich in anti-oxidants can combat oxidative tension, which might harm the eyes. Carrots, spinach, and citrus fruits are excellent options for promoting vision.


Staying hydrated is also important for preserving eye dampness. A well balanced diet plan integrated with correct hydration sustains total eye feature and health.
